Government raises salaries of military personnel
The Belarusian government has raised the salaries of the Armed Forces staff.
According to the defense ministry’s newspaper Belorusskaya Voyennaya Gazeta, contract personnel serving in positions ranking from the first to the ninth category have had their salaries raised by 42 to 48 percent, whereas the salaries of commissioned officers serving in positions ranking from the 11th to the 53rd category have been increased by 26 to 43 percent.
The average after-tax salary of the Belarusian military officers in January will thus be 20 percent higher than in December 2011, Belorusskaya Voyennaya Gazeta said.
Since the First-Class Worker Rate, used for calculating pay rates in the public sector, was raised by 32.5 percent – from 151,000 to 200,000 rubels ($24) – on January 1, the allowances paid to the contract personnel have increased by 32 percent on the average, the paper said.
According to it, the students of the Military Academy of Belarus and the military departments of civilian higher education institutions are to be paid 230,000 rubels in January compared with 154,000 in December, while the cadets of Suvorov Minsk Military School have had their monthly allowance increased from 37,750 to 50,000 rubels ($6). //BelaPAN
